Carbon Fixation
The process by which inorganic carbon (typically carbon dioxide) is converted to organic compounds by living organisms, crucial in the synthesis of glucose during photosynthesis.
Rubisco
Ribulose bisphosphate carboxylase. Carbon-fixing enzyme of the Calvin–Benson cycle.
Electron Transfer Chains
A series of protein complexes and molecular carriers involved in the transfer of electrons through a membrane to generate ATP.
Light-Dependent Reactions
The photosynthesis phase where light energy is converted into chemical energy in the form of ATP and NADPH.
